The physical demands described here are a represent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
Physical requirements
Talk and hear, stand and walk for prolonged periods, frequently bend, stoop, and kneel. Regularly lift and/or move up to 10 pounds, frequently up to 25 pounds, and occasionally up to 35 pounds.
Work environment
Warehouse environment; temperatures can be hot or cold seasonally.
Capstone is a North American supply chain solutions partner with more than 650 operating locations, 19,000 associates, and 60,000 carriers. We offer capabilities in freight management, warehouse and distribution center support, last-mile delivery, supply chain analytics, and optimization.
